The Manila Hotel

9.3/10
Great
Posted on Jun 21, 2026
GBGuest User
The Manila Hotel has an old but elegant and luxurious style. Marble and stone finishing, tall ceilings and a grand piano at the back with a musician playing pleasant music greets you as you walk through the entrance. Lacking points from my personal experience: 1. The carpet floors need to be replaced. I had to change rooms because the first room I got had an unpleasant smell to it (they quickly changed my room after I went to the reception, so it wasn't terrible) and although I didn't notice until the end of my stay, the new room's carpet was frayed at the edges. 2. The night mode of the lights (many switches) completely cuts power to the power outlets. I didn't know and ended up waking up to a phone and power bank with a dying battery and needing to stay in the hotel a couple of hours until they finished charging. Maybe just a warning in the future? The good parts: 1. The service! People are SO accommodating, pleasant and efficient. Reception staff, waiters, bell boys and basically everyone greets you with a smile and tries to solve any problems with utmost focus and cordiality. 2. Traditional pride. Traditional fashion exhibition at the front was a great touch to my visit. The whole place (restaurants, pools, spa, rooms, etc) add to the experience. I could have stayed in the hotel and felt like I hadn't missed Manila's charm. 3. Excellent location. I realised early on that I could literally see every single thing from my ”1 day tour of Manila” from my hotel room. Nothing says great location like this.
